Manchester United have reportedly identified Antoine Semenyo of Bournemouth and Crystal Palace’s Eberechi Eze as alternative targets if they fail to strike an agreement with Brentford over a fee for Bryan Mbeumo.
Mbeumo has become one of the most in-demand players of the summer as the transfer window gathers pace.
The Cameroonian enjoyed a breakout 2024/25 season, plundering a career-high 20 Premier League goals. Only Mohamed Salah, Erling Haaland and Alexander Isak netted more times than the Brentford man.
Since joining the Bees from Troyes in 2019, Mbeumo has been a quietly consistent presence for the side but in the just-concluded campaign, he truly put himself on the map with his impressive performances and numbers. It was only a matter of time until clubs came calling.
United had an opening bid worth a total £55m rejected by Brentford, who are holding out for more. The two clubs remain in talks to try and find a compromise. Mbeumo has already chosen United and is keen on becoming the latest addition to Ruben Amorim’s ranks.
But, in recent hours, it has emerged that Tottenham Hotspur – emboldened by the managerial appointment of Thomas Frank, who left Brentford for North London – have entered the fray for Mbeumo and are looking to hijack United’s deal for the forward.
United are still believed to be in pole position even as Tottenham circle but a recent report covered by The Peoples Person relayed that the Red Devils will not hesitate to walk away from negotiations if Brentford do not demonstrate a willingness to compromise on their valuation.
This has now been confirmed by ESPN, who relay that United CEO Omar Berrada has a price in mind for Mbeumo and the club will not exceed it.
If a transfer fails to get over the line, United will turn their attention elsewhere.
ESPN state, “[United] want Bryan Mbeumo from Brentford but, according to sources, will refuse to pay beyond Berrada’s predetermined ‘price point.’”
“Other options include Bournemouth’s Antoine Semenyo and Eberechi Eze at Crystal Palace.”
Berrada and his team are reportedly determined to correct the transfer missteps of recent years, when United were often lured into overpaying for players who ultimately failed to justify their hefty price tags after arriving at Old Trafford.
